Title: Michiko Ogino: Innovator in Optical Glass Technology
Introduction
Michiko Ogino is a prominent inventor based in Sagamihara, Japan, known for her significant contributions to the field of optical glass technology. With a total of nine patents to her name, she has made remarkable advancements that prioritize environmental sustainability and optical performance.
Latest Patents
Among her latest innovations, Ogino has developed optical glass that is free from lead, a known environmental pollutant. This optical glass is designed for optimal light transmission, even after exposure to X-rays, and boasts a high refractive index. The composition includes 1.0% to 60.0% of an SiO component, along with essential elements such as LaO, ZrO, TiO, NbO, and TaO. Additionally, she has created another type of optical glass characterized by a high refractive index of not less than 1.75 and an Abbe's number of not less than 35. This glass maintains its image formation characteristics despite temperature fluctuations, showcasing her innovative approach to material science.
